The reinsurance broker is a mediator between the insurance company and reinsurers playing a vital role in placing the risk and substantial business that underwritten in the ceding company office either by reinsurance treaty or facultative reinsurance placing and get a reinsurance brokerage from the ceding company for this job. As far as I know in London market the reinsurers dose not accept any risk unless that comes or introduced by a registered broker , that is to say they are not accepting direct reinsurance offers from the ceding companies.

The main role of a reinsurance broker is to bring insurance company (ceding office) and reinsurer into a relationship in the form of a reinsurance contract. In other words, reinsurance broker will assist insurance companies in placing different risks with reinsurance markets for several purposes. Additionally, reinsurance broker may hold other responsibilities which depends on the terms of the reinsurance contract.
